Flickr Users Can Now Post Pictures from Photoshop Express

Photoshop Express to Flickr

Photoshop Express, the free online image editor from Adobe, has added support for Flickr. It now allows users to access their Flickr accounts from within the application and post pictures to the photo sharing site.

This update is one of two most requested features by users of the Photoshop Express, which is still on its beta testing stage. The other most requested feature is the Save As functionality, which has also been added.

Additionally, a new embeddable player will allow users to post their Photoshop Express slideshows to sites such as Facebook, Myspace, blogs and others.

Photoshop Express, which debuted last March, is a free rich Internet application (RIA) offered to users who want to store, sort and show off digital photos with eye-catching effects. The service is currently available only in the U.S.
